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Gypsy Lane to Turkey Street start from as little as £24.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Gypsy Lane to Turkey Street start from £88.00 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Gypsy Lane to Turkey Street are available for £197.60 one way

Station Facilities at Gypsy Lane

Though a quaint and modest station, Gypsy Lane is equipped with essential facilities that ensure an easy travel experience. Ticket machines are available where you can collect tickets purchased online or in advance. These machines are designed to be accessible to everyone, including those requiring mobility support. Although there's no ticket office or staff assistance directly at the station, help is available via the helpline.

For your security, CCTV operates throughout the station, offering peace of mind as you await your train. However, facilities such as to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ment centers, and car parking are not available. So, it's a good idea to come prepared!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with two cycling spaces available.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Pondering on how to get to or from Gypsy Lane? Although the station itself does not have direct bus services or taxi ranks, alternative travel options are easily accessed. Rail replacement services pick up and drop off at Cypress Road Bus Stops, conveniently located adjacent to the Brunton Arms pub. If you're thinking of getting a taxi, you can explore options online via services like Cab4You. Unfortunately, bus services are not available in close proximity to the station.

Station Facilities and Ticketing

Turkey Street station is equipped with a variety of facilities to make your journey convenient.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 10:00 on weekdays and from 09:45 to 13:00 on Saturdays, ensuring you have access to purchase tickets. Plus, ticket machines are available for a quick and easy self-service option. Online ticket purchases are easily collected at these machines as well, making your entry into the station seamless. The station also includes an induction loop to assist those who are hearing impaired.

Accessibility

While Turkey Street offers accessible ticket machines and seating areas, the station lacks step-free access and other amenities like ramps for train access. However, there are help points available if you need assistance. CCTV cameras provide additional security, so you can feel safe while you travel.

Beyond the Station: Transport Links

Turkey Street station offers seamless onward connections to keep your journey going smoothly. Transport for London buses operate right from outside the station, providing you a convenient transition from train to bus. For rail replacement services, use bus stop G for northbound services to Cheshunt and bus stop L for southbound services to Liverpool Street, ensuring you’re never stuck on your journey.
